The goo.gl service provides analytics details and a QR code generator.[citation needed] On 30 March 2018 Google announced that it is "turning down support for goo.gl over the coming weeks and replacing it with Firebase Dynamic Links" (although existing goo.gl links will continue to function).[19] Advantages[edit] The main advantage of a short link is that it is, in fact, short, looks neat and clean and can be easily communicated and entered without error.[20] To a very limited extent it may obscure the destination of the URL, though easily discoverable; this may be advantageous, disadvantageous, or irrelevant. The shortest possible long-term URLs were generated by NanoURL from December 2009 until about 2011, associated with the top-level .to (Tonga) domain, in the form , where xxxx represents a sequence of random numbers and letters.[15] On 14 December 2009 Google announced a service called Google URL Shortener at goo.gl, which originally was only available for use through Google products (such as Google Toolbar and FeedBurner) and extensions for Google Chrome.[17] On 21 December 2009, Google introduced a YouTube URL Shortener, youtu.be.[18] From September 2010 Google URL Shortener became available via a direct interface.
